WebNov 29, 2024 · Each taster should have a flight of at least 5 whiskeys for variation, and probably no more than 8, or risk palate fatigue. Bear in mind … WebMar 24, 2016 · Appearance. Whisky should be served at room temperature, between 18° and 22°C (64° and 72°F). Tasting favours quality over quantity and a few centilitres (ounces) of whisky (2 to 4 centilitres/¾ to 1½ ounces maximum) is enough. Tilt the glass sideways and rotate it to make a complete circle.
